The DEWALT DCK551D1M1 bundle combines essential cordless tools in a compact package, designed for tight spaces and a wide range of applications. The DCD771 drill/driver provides a high-performance motor with 300 unit watts out (UWO) for tasks from drilling into wood to light masonry. The DCF885 compact impact driver reaches into narrow gaps with a 5.55-inch front-to-back profile, improving access in furniture, cabinetry, and automotive projects. This set typically includes a 20V MAX battery and a charger, ensuring you’re ready for work without frequent battery swaps. The combination emphasizes versatility, durability, and DEWALT’s typical build quality, making it suitable for homeowners and pros alike who need a reliable starter or upgrade kit.

This two-battery kit focuses on delivering the core drilling and driving tasks with convenience. The DCD771 drill/driver features a two-speed transmission (0-450 and 0-1500 RPM) for precise control, while the DCD771 motor outputs 300 UWO to handle a broad range of materials. The compact design fits into tight spaces, letting you work on overhead shelves, cabinetry, or vehicle interiors without fatigue. The DCK240C2 kit provides solid value with dependable performance and a familiar DEWALT workflow for DIYers and professionals updating their portable toolkit.

The PCCK6118 kit brings together a broad range of tools in a single 20V MAX system. It includes a 1/2-inch drill/driver with a two-speed gearbox (0-350/0-1,500) and a 1/4-inch impact driver with a maximum torque of 1,450 in-lbs, plus a quick-release chuck. The circular saw offers a high-performance motor (3,700 RPM) with a 50-degree bevel, as well as a 5-1/2-inch carbide blade for wood cuts. This kit suits DIYers who want a broad tool suite without leaving the 20V platform, enabling a variety of home improvement tasks from framing to finishing touches.

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ations

  • Tool variety vs. task needs: A larger kit covers more tasks but may be heavier and pricier. Match tool count to your typical projects, such as woodworking, metalwork, or general home maintenance.
  • Voltage platform: All kits here use 20V MAX systems. Consistency across tools minimizes battery clutter and maximizes compatibility.
  • Torque and speed control: Look for adjustable speed settings and adequate torque (UWO) for the materials you work with. Higher torque helps with dense woods and tough fasteners.
  • Ergonomics and weight: Compact designs reduce user fatigue, especially for overhead or extended use. Consider grip comfort and balance for long sessions.
  • Battery life and charging: Two-battery kits reduce downtime. Check included chargers and the availability of compatible batteries for future expansion.
  • Accessories and compatibility: Some sets include blades, bits, and sanders—assess if you’ll need extra blades or sanding papers for immediate use.
  • Brand ecosystem: Sticking with a single brand can simplify maintenance and battery interchangeability across tools in the same platform.
  • Warranty and support: A reliable warranty and accessible service support can save costs in case of wear or defect.

When selecting a power tool set, consider how often you tackle jobs that involve drilling, driving, cutting, or sanding. If you frequently work in tight spaces, prioritize compact drills and drivers with good accessibility. For larger remodeling or carpentry tasks, a kit with multiple saws and a robust reciprocating saw can reduce tool changes and increase efficiency. Battery capacity and charging speed matter for longer sessions, while the overall tool quality influences long-term reliability and result quality.
